Company Profile

With more than 120 operations and approximately 20,000 employees worldwide, Precision Castparts Corp. is the market leader in manufacturing large, complex structural investment castings, airfoil castings, forged components, aerostructures and highly engineered, critical fasteners for aerospace applications. In addition, we are the leading producer of airfoil castings for the industrial gas turbine market. We also manufacture extruded seamless pipe, fittings, and forgings for power generation and oil & gas applications; commercial and military airframe aerostructures; and metal alloys and other materials for the casting and forging industries. With such critical applications, we insist on quality and dependability - not just in the materials and products we make, but in the people we recruit.

PCC is relentless in its dedication to being a high-quality, low-cost and on-time producer; delivering the highest value to its customers while continually pursuing strategic, profitable growth.

In 2016, Berkshire Hathaway, led by Chairman and CEO Warren E. Buffett, acquired Precision Castparts Corp.

Job Description

Under general supervision, inspects the surface condition of castings using specialized equipment and a liquid Penetrant, using predetermined inspection methods approved by Quality Assurance, to ensure conformance to customer requirements in accordance with quality standards. Ensures that documentation, tooling, and parts are correctly matched to paperwork. Ensure castings are defect free; conform to production guidelines and customer requirements by performing penetrant inspection functions following established NDT inspection methods, conforming to specifications on technique cards.

Essential Job Functions:

* Follow established housekeeping and safety practices to maintain the quality of the work.
* Demonstrate ability to log on main computer system, extract information, log time, enter inventory amount and forward to next operation.
* Possess the ability to handle tote boxes and castings weighing up to 35 pounds.
* Have read and demonstrated the ability to understand QCP 7.2 and ATM-E 1417.
* You must pass a current visual acuity test (eye exam) and annually thereafter.
* Demonstrates the ability to perform all tests and calibrations in the Penetrant area.
* Demonstrates an understanding of all times and temperatures used in the penetrant operation defined in QCP 7.2.
* Demonstrates the current washing techniques, temperature, distance, angle, and time per QCP
* 7.2.
* Demonstrates an acceptable level of operator proficiency with acceptable accuracy. (Basket loading, developing, temperature control, washing time).
* Demonstrates the ability how to change penetrant oil.
* Demonstrates ability to follow technique cards.
* Capable of processing castings smoothly through racking, dipping, washing, drying and developing in such a manner that Level II readers are provided a continuous flow of work.
* Understands that you must pass the requalification exam when requested.
* Fully understands plant routing documents, such as travelers, printouts, scrap tickets, and rework tickets.
* Understands sampling method used when specified.
* Understands that this position requires him/her to help train personnel of lower levels.
* Understands that level II personnel are responsible for accepting castings and therefore are
* responsible for processing of their castings.
* Must pass the Level I Penetrant Test with a score of 80% or better on all portions.
* Understands that tinted or photo gray eyeglasses cannot be used when processing parts.
* Must pass Gage R & R Test with a score of 90% or better and have no more than 10% deviation. Deviation in either direction (over/under inspection).
* Must have completed or be in the process of completing required "procedure" training (OPC's, QCP's, QSM's, HSP's, ASP's, etc.).
* Performs all other duties assigned.

This position requires use of information or access to production processes subject to national security controls under U.S. export control laws and regulations (including, but not limited to the International Traffic in Arms Regulations (ITAR) and the Export Administration Regulations (EAR)). To be qualified to work in this facility, a successful applicant must be a U.S. Person, as defined in those regulations, and able to supply evidence of that qualification prior to starting work or be authorized to receive controlled information under a specific license or permission from the relevant government agency. The U.S. export control regulations define a U.S. person as a U.S. Citizen, U.S. National, U.S. Permanent Resident (i.e. 'Green Card Holder'), and certain categories of Asylees and Refugees.
